NEW ROADS FOUNDATION, founded in 2011, is a community nonprofit in the Mental Health sector that reported $5.3M in total revenue in fiscal year 2025. Expenses of $5.2M left a modest 3% surplus.

Mission

TO HELP CREATE LIVES WORTH LIVING.
